The Kollmorgen AKM42J-ACCN2-00 is a synchronous servo motor from the AKM Synchronous Servo Motors series with a frame dimension of 84mm and an IEC flange configuration with accuracy N. It features a single turn, optical Comcoder feedback system with a resolution of 2048 lines per revolution and includes 2 SpeedTec Ready connectors without a brake.

Product Description:
The AKM42J-ACCN2-00 is a brushless AC servo motor produced by Kollmorgen within the AKM Synchronous Servo Motors series. It is engineered for closed-loop positioning and velocity control, and it couples directly to precision machinery while transmitting commanded torque with low rotor inertia. In automated assembly cells, packaging lines, and semiconductor handling stations, the unit serves as the rotary actuator that follows drive-generated motion profiles with repeatable accuracy.
For mechanical integration, the motor is delivered without a brake, so any load-holding function must be provided by the drive or by an external locking device. Two power and feedback leads exit through two SpeedTec Ready connectors, permitting tool-free quarter-turn mating and quick cable connection. Rotor position is detected by a Comcoder that supplies incremental and commutation signals at a native resolution of 2048 lines/rev, enabling tight servo loop bandwidth. The front face measures 84 mm square, allowing the motor to fit into compact multi-axis stages while still delivering moderate continuous torque. Thermal balance and electrical constants are set by the J winding, which matches typical 230-VAC drives.
The feedback chain is reinforced by a single-turn optical feedback track, eliminating cumulative turn count errors during rapid reversals. Its code wheel follows the EPC 15T format, so the connected drive can read absolute commutation vectors immediately after power-up. Mounting accuracy is governed by an IEC flange with accuracy N, providing consistent pilot centering for repeatable shaft alignment. Torque is transferred through a keyway shaft, a detail that simplifies coupling to pulleys, gearboxes, or rigid hubs without relying on friction alone. The rotor length index 2 supports a compact motor length for general-purpose automation axes.
